Onion: Nutritional Profile

Contents:

Onions add flavor to dishes without contributing significant calories. Onions contain substantial amounts of folate, Vitamin C, calcium, iron, magnesium, manganese, phosphorus, potassium, and zinc. They may help control sugar, which is helpful for people with diabetes or prediabetes.

100 grams of onions contain the following nutrients:

Carbs: 9 g Sugar: 4. 2 g Fat: 0% Protein: 1% Calories: 40 Onions contain quercetin and organic sulfur compounds, which help to promote insulin production in the body. Hence, onions become helpful in controlling blood sugar levels. 100 grams of red onion reduce fasting blood sugar levels by 40mg/dl after four hours.

Ways To Consume Onion For Diabetes

1. Onion Juice

Chop peeled onion into small pieces and add them to a blender. Add some water and blend well. Extract the juice using a strainer. Add 1-2 teaspoons of honey and mix well and consume it as juice.

2. Cucumber And Onion Salad

Chop half an onion and half a cucumber and mix them properly in a bowl. Add lemon juice, salt, and pepper as per your taste and mix it before consuming.

Best Time To Consume Onion For Diabetes

You can take onions in a salad before food. You can consume onions for diabetes at any time if you do not have any other preexisting health conditions. However, avoid eating onions at night, as it has been found that eating them can increase heartburn and cause reflex when you lie down at night.

Risks of Over Consuming Onion For Diabetes

The carbs in onions may cause gas and bloating. Diallyl disulfide and lipid transfer protein are certain compounds present in onions. These can lead to allergy symptoms like runny nose, asthma, red eyes, itchy rashes, and contact dermatitis.
